About the Game
Sprunk But Bob is a casual music-mixing game inspired by the popular drag-and-drop rhythm formula. Players become the producer, selecting sound elements and assigning them to performers standing on stage.
The main objective is to create a song by combining different audio layers. Each icon introduces a unique sound, ranging from percussion and bass to melodies and vocal effects. As more characters join the performance, the composition becomes richer and more complex.
At the beginning, the stage is filled with silent stone-like skull figures. Once a sound is assigned, they transform into animated musicians that contribute to the growing track. Since there are no restrictions on experimentation, players can continuously remix and refine their creations.
How to Play
Controls
Use the mouse to drag sound icons onto available characters. Click a performer at any time to remove its sound and free the slot for another choice.
Basic Gameplay
Select sounds from the collection below the stage and place them onto the waiting Bobs. Listen carefully to how each layer blends with the others. Rearrange sounds, swap performers, and experiment with different combinations until the music feels complete.
Winning Goal
There is no score counter or final level. The goal is to produce a musical arrangement you enjoy and discover creative sound combinations through experimentation.

Tips
- Begin with rhythm sounds before adding melodic layers.
- Test each new sound individually to understand its role.
- Remove cluttered audio combinations that overpower the mix.
- Experiment with unusual pairings to discover interesting results.
- Adjust your lineup frequently to create fresh musical patterns.
